What a great way to celebrate Juneteenth by kayaking at a Black-owned, non-profit on the Patuxent River in Upper Marlboro, MD. Riverkeeper and CEO, Fred Tutman founded the Riverkeeper in 2004 to advocate for clean water in Maryland and to expose the Black community to water sports, such as kayaking. ACT3 Explorations is honored to bring you along and spend the morning on such historic grounds.

After kayaking, we'll enjoy wine and light refreshments at Robin Hill Farm & Vineyard. Bring your friends and family for a full day of adventure and fun to celebrate Juneteenth.
